  1. Make a Plan

Planning is always the first step to creating a beautiful lawn. Without planning your lawn may end up looking messy or costing you more money than it should. 

You should decide what you want to use your lawn for. Do you entertain guests often? Do you want a large garden area? Do you plan on installing something like a water feature? 

Planning will help you stay within your budget and develop a timeline for your lawn’s makeover. 

  1. Know Your Priorities

Deciding what to prioritize always makes the process of landscaping easier.

What do you want to be done first?

Many people choose to begin in their front yard because it is what most people see. Redoing your front yard increases your curb appeal and impresses your neighbors. 

Yet, you may want to begin with designing a backyard if you plan to install a pool, fireplace, or sitting area. It’s great to start with larger projects like this first as they normally cost the most.

  1. Build a Retaining Wall

Depending on your yard, you may consider building a retaining wall. Retaining walls are sturdy walls built to support soil laterally. They are great for creating more usable land space and retaining slopes. 

The benefits of retaining walls are numerous. Retaining walls can increase the value of your home. They can also be built from several beautiful materials including brick, gabion, wood, natural stone, and more.

  1. Keep Your Yard Neat

Keeping your yard neat seems like a no-brainer. After all this work of course you’re going to keep your yard looking great. But, people get busy and forget to make time to do maintenance. 

Make yard maintenance part of your plan. Choose days ahead of time to devote to mowing, watering, pruning, and weeding.

If you know you are going on vacation or you aren’t going to have time to do upkeep you can hire someone to do it for you. 

  1. Know How to Water

The most important tip out of all of these landscaping tips is to know how to water your lawn and plants. 

Different plants have different care guidelines. Becoming familiar with what each of your plants’ needs will save you from a dead or sick lawn. Be very careful that you are not overwatering or underwatering your plants. 

Creating a watering schedule may save you from killing your plants. But, if you find that you don’t have time to stick to this schedule, installing a sprinkler system in your yard may help you immensely.
